A police officer's death in Laval, Quebec was the result of incomplete verification of gun registry information and an insufficient risk assessment before entering a residence during a drug raid.rnDaniel Tessier died on March 2, 2007. At about 5 am that day, a team of five police investigators, as part of efforts to bust a drug-selling ring, were carrying out a search of a private residence, the CSST reports in a statement. Entering the home, the officers shouted "Police," and a shoot-out quickly followed. Tessier was hit three times and later died.
